Key Features
- The 8025 dual ball fan size is 80mmx80mmx25mm/3.15inx3.15inx1in.
- Rated Current: 0.35Amp; Speed: 4500RPM ; Air flow: 59CFM ; Noise: 43dBA; Rated Voltage: DC 12V.
- Lead wire: UL Type (+): Red wire ; (-): Black wire. This is a two wire cooling fan; Life: working up to 50000h at 25 degrees.
- Connector: 2 terminal connector with 2pin-ph2.5.
- 8025 fan designed to cool various electronics and components, improve air flow. Cool CPU , make your PC more durable.
